Malloc la gi
WebMar 17, 2024 · The Malloc() Function. This function is used for allocating a block of memory in bytes at runtime. It returns a void pointer, which points to the base address of … Web16 thg 8, 2014 virco. Sự khác biệt 1: malloc () thường phân bổ khối bộ nhớ và nó là phân đoạn bộ nhớ khởi tạo. calloc () phân bổ khối bộ nhớ và khởi tạo tất cả khối bộ nhớ thành 0. Sự khác biệt 2: Nếu bạn xem xét cú pháp malloc (), nó sẽ chỉ mất 1 đối số. Hãy xem ...
Malloc la gi
Did you know?
WebAug 10, 2011 · If you do need to use a malloc -like function, in C++, consider using the function operator new, which interfaces with the rest of the memory system (it throws exceptions, calls the new handler if memory can't be … Webmalloc là một hàm để cấp phát bộ nhớ động trong tệp tiêu đề stdlib.h của ngôn ngữ C phân bổ một số byte cụ thể. Ý nghĩa calloc là viết tắt của phân bổ liền kề. malloc là viết tắt …
WebJun 19, 2024 · Hi. chào mừng các bạn đến với chủ đề học lập trình c++ nâng cao. Hôm nay chúng ta cùng tìm hiểu về sự khác nhau giữa: new trong c++ và malloc trong c. Nếu nhưng trong c việc cấp phát bộ nhớ động được sử dụng bởi cơ chế malloc, thì trong c++ được thay thế bằng cách sử ... WebJul 26, 2024 · malloc() là 1 trong những hàm cấp phát vùng nhớhay được dùng độc nhất, nó chất nhận được thực hiện việccấp phép bộghi nhớ từ vùng nhớ còn thoải mái.Tmê mẩn …
WebMar 29, 2016 · Cả 2 hàm malloc () và calloc () đều được sử dụng để cấp phát vùng nhớ động cho chương trình. Nếu cấp phát vùng nhớ thành công, hàm trả về con trỏ trỏ tới vùng nhớ được cấp phát. Hàm trả về NULL nếu không đủ vùng nhớ. Hàm malloc () và calloc () trả về NULL trong các trường hợp sau: WebJun 29, 2016 · You need an offset if you want to support alignments beyond what your system's malloc () does. For example if your system malloc () aligns to 8 byte …
WebJun 5, 2011 · malloc chỉ dùng để lấy một số bytes của memory C Code: Select All Show/Hide void * malloc ( size_t size ); Allocates a block of size bytes of memory, returning a pointer to the beginning of the block. The content of the newly allocated block of memory is not initialized, remaining with indeterminate values.
WebMar 27, 2024 · malloc() calloc() 1. It is a function that creates one block of memory of a fixed size. It is a function that assigns more than one block of memory to a single variable. 2. It only takes one argument: It takes two arguments. 3. It is faster than calloc. It is slower than malloc() 4. It has high time efficiency: It has low time efficiency: 5. filthy fifteen songsWebDefined in header . void* aligned_alloc( std::size_t alignment, std::size_t size ); (since C++17) Allocate size bytes of uninitialized storage whose alignment is specified by alignment. The size parameter must be an integral multiple of alignment . The following functions are required to be thread-safe: filthy fifty women\u0027s rxWebSep 8, 2024 · Hãy xem xét đoạn mã C++ đơn giản sau với con trỏ bình thường. 1. 2. 3. MyClass* ptr = new MyClass(); ptr->doSomething(); Bằng cách sử dụng Smart Pointer, ta có thể làm cho con trỏ hoạt động theo cách mà ta không cần phải gọi delete một cách tường minh. Smart pointer là một lớp bao bọc ... filthy fifteen song listWebFeb 6, 2024 · The malloc function allocates a memory block of at least size bytes. The block may be larger than size bytes because of the space that's required for alignment and … grpn earnings reportWebBEGIN_AS_NAMESPACE #ifdef WIP_16BYTE_ALIGN // TODO: Add support for 16byte aligned application types (e.g. __m128). The following is a list of things that needs to be implemented: // // ok - The script context must make sure to always allocate the local stack memory buffer on 16byte aligned boundaries (asCContext::ReserveStackSpace) // ok - … filthy fifty crossfit wodWebĐịnh nghĩa hàm malloc() trong C. Hàm malloc() cấp phát bộ nhớ được yêu cầu và trả về một con trỏ tới nó. Khai báo hàm malloc() trong C. Dưới đây là phần khai báo cho malloc() trong C: void *malloc(kich-co) Tham số. kich-co: Đây là kích cỡ của khối bộ nhớ (bằng byte). Trả về giá trị grpn marketwatchWebHàm calloc() trong C. Hàm void *calloc(so-phan-tu, kich-co-phan-tu) cấp phát bộ nhớ được yêu cầu và trả về một con trỏ tới nó. Điểm khác nhau giữa malloc và calloc là: malloc … filthy filly